Cardio-hepatic risk assessment by CMR imaging in liver transplant candidates

Clinical Transplantation
Sahadev T ReddyRobert W W Biederman

Abstract

The preoperative workup of orthotopic liver transplantation (OLT) patients is practically complex given the need for multiple imaging modalities. We recently demonstrated in our proof-of-concept study the value of a one-stop-shop approach using cardiovascular MRI (CMR) to address this complex problem. However, this approach requires further validation in a larger cohort, as detection of hepatocellular carcinoma (HCC) as well as cardiovascular risk assessment is critically important in these patients. We hypothesized that coronary risk assessment and HCC detectability is acceptable using the one-stop-shop CMR approach. In this observational study, patients underwent CMRI evaluation including cardiac function, stress CMR, thoracoabdominal MRA, and abdominal MRI on a standard MRI scanner in one examination. Over 8 years, 252 OLT candidates underwent evaluation in the cardiac MRI suit. The completion rates for each segment of the CMR examination were 99% for function, 95% completed stress CMR, 93% completed LGE for viability, 85% for liver MRI, and 87% for MRA.
